Hello all! I finally got the other female I was waiting on, although one female quickly became two! The lady brought my two so that I could pick between them, but also offered both. I couldn't help but take both of them as they're already a bonded little pair from the breeder, and trios work best anyways, so now I can have a full little group after quarantine is up.

I decided on the names Mogwai (Mog-why) and Mowgli (Mo-glee), and they're the cutest little things.

They have been on full explore everything mode since I have taken them home and I definitely understand what everyone means when they talk about each mouse having a completely separate personality. Mogwai is wheel and food focused, and Mowgli is a little more shy yet curious and seems to be a determined little nest builder.

Anyways I'm going to do a 4 week quarantine, but I was wondering if during that time period I could take toys and such from Bird (my female mouse who they will meet) and put them in the duos cage? Obviously this would not go vice versa but just wondering if it'll help when they eventually meet so that the pair already knows her scent.

Also any tips for introducing a duo to a single? I've heard that a dab of vanilla on their backside can help, anyone ever tried it?
